Any TS consists of an analytical unit (AB) generating entry/exit points and an MM maximising the process of converting pips into rubles.

Any martin, is essentially a disguised MM, and a non-optimal one at that.

What is Reshetov going to discuss or prove? MM, but for a particular AB there is an optimal MM (there is a good article about it and the problem is considered applied).

Questions to Yury V:


- What is the loss-profit ratio shown on historical data?

- What is the maximal number of losing trades in a row obtained on the history (during the testing period)? (e.g. 2 or 4 consecutive losing trades).

- Have you tried to shift the order limit, for example by 10-20 pips away from your optimum value, and watch the increase of successive stops? It is clear that it increases, but by how many in a row?


The answers to these questions will help predict the future of the strategy being tested. And then it will be interesting to compare these predictions with practical results.
